Just returned from Hampstead, N.H. and found the following: >>>>> >>>>>John Bond, b. Jan 14, 1718 in Haverhill Mass., son of John and ____ >>(Hall) >>>>Bond of >>>>>Haverhill (Mass.) His father drowned May 21, 1721 in the Merrimack >river. >>>>He was a >>>>>doctor in Hampstead for many years. He married Judith Dow >(Haverhill, >>>>Mass.) and >>>>>had six children. (Memorial History of Hampstead, N.H., Voll II >(Church). >>>>> >>>>>I also found one of his sons, John, Jr., (married Mary Moulton), was >a >>>>doctor in >>>>>Hampstead, N.H. for many years.
